The Rise Of At Home DNA Testing: Benefits And Considerations

In recent years, at home DNA testing has gained popularity as a convenient and affordable way for individuals to learn more about their genetic makeup These tests, which can be ordered online and completed in the comfort of one’s own home, offer insights into ancestry, health predispositions, and even potential genetic traits However, as with any form of genetic testing, there are important considerations to keep in mind when opting for an at home DNA test.

One of the main reasons for the surge in popularity of at home DNA testing is the accessibility and convenience it provides Rather than having to schedule an appointment with a healthcare provider or genetic counselor, individuals can simply order a test kit online and collect their DNA sample at home This can be especially appealing for those who live in remote areas or have busy schedules that make it difficult to find the time for traditional testing methods.

Another benefit of at home DNA testing is the ability to learn more about one’s ancestry and genetic heritage Many people are curious about their family history and ethnic background, and DNA testing can provide valuable insights into their genetic roots These tests can also help individuals connect with relatives they may not have known about, expanding their family tree and creating a sense of belonging.

In addition to ancestry information, at home DNA testing can also reveal potential health predispositions Certain genetic variations are associated with an increased risk of developing certain conditions, such as heart disease, cancer, or Alzheimer’s By identifying these predispositions early on, individuals can take proactive steps to manage their health and reduce their risk of developing these conditions in the future.

However, it is important to approach at home DNA testing with caution and consider some key factors before deciding to proceed with the test One crucial consideration is the privacy and security of genetic information When individuals submit their DNA sample for testing, they are essentially entrusting a third-party company with their most sensitive and personal data at home dna test. It is essential to research the testing company thoroughly and ensure that they have strict privacy policies in place to protect customers’ information.

Another consideration is the accuracy and reliability of at home DNA testing kits While these tests can provide valuable insights into one’s genetic makeup, they are not always 100% accurate Factors such as sample collection, processing techniques, and the size of the testing database can all impact the reliability of the results It is important to be aware of the limitations of at home DNA testing and consult with a healthcare provider or genetic counselor for a more comprehensive understanding of the results.

Furthermore, individuals should be prepared for the potential emotional impact of at home DNA testing results Discovering unexpected information about one’s ancestry or health can be a source of joy or distress, depending on the individual’s perspective It is important to approach the results with an open mind and seek support from loved ones or professionals if needed.
